# RFC: Lower the Node engines floor to 22.18
|
||||
|
||||
Status: implemented
|
||||
|
||||
## Problem
|
||||
|
||||
The root `engines.node` was `>=24`, which excluded the entire Node 22 LTS line for no runtime reason. The harness has exactly two Node features whose availability gates the floor, and both are satisfied well below Node 24 — so the floor was higher than the code actually requires. Pinning it honestly widens the supported install base (Node 22 LTS is in service until 2027) without weakening any guarantee, provided CI proves the claim on the floor version rather than merely asserting it in a manifest.
|
||||
|
||||
## Decision
|
||||
|
||||
Set `engines.node` to `^22.18.0 || >=24.0.0` (Node 22.18+ on the LTS line, or 24+) and test it on the keyless CI matrix `['22.18', 24, 26]`. The real-API e2e workflow stays on Node 24 because it exercises API integration rather than the runtime floor. Two Node features gate the range, each with its own LTS-line and Current-line unflag point:
|
||||
|
||||
- **`node:sqlite`** — `packages/session-persistence/session-persistence-sqlite` does a top-level `import { DatabaseSync } from 'node:sqlite'`. The module dropped its `--experimental-sqlite` flag requirement at **22.13** (LTS) and **23.4** (Current); before those, importing it throws at load.
|
||||
- **Native TypeScript type-stripping** — the `packages/ui/stdio-agent/tests/built-bin.e2e.ts` smoke boots the published `lib/bin.js` under plain `node` (no tsx) and loads the example's `.ts` plugins (`mock-llm.ts`, `echo-tool.ts`). Type-stripping is the default from **22.18** (LTS) and **23.6** (Current); before those it needs `--experimental-strip-types`.
|
||||
|
||||
On the 22.x line both features clear at **22.18** (the later of 22.13/22.18), so `^22.18.0` is the LTS floor. The range is **disjoint** rather than an open `>=22.18` because the Node **23.0–23.5** window still has at least one feature flagged (sqlite until 23.4, stripping until 23.6): `>=22.18` would advertise support there, where the sqlite backend throws `ERR_UNKNOWN_BUILTIN_MODULE` at load. Node 23 is non-LTS and already end-of-life, so rather than carve out `>=23.6` the range skips the whole line and resumes at `>=24.0.0` — the same shape several of the repo's own dependencies already declare (`^22.18.0 || >=24.11.0`).
|
||||
|
||||
`@types/node` is pinned to the 22.x line (`^22.20.0`) to match the floor: reaching for a Node 23+/24+/25+ API then fails `tsc` on every machine and in the typecheck gate, rather than compiling clean and surviving to a runtime failure only the 22.18 matrix leg could catch. The whole tree typechecks clean against the Node 22 type surface today, so the pin costs nothing.
|
||||
|
||||
## Consequences
|
||||
|
||||
- The supported base widens to the Node 22 LTS line, and the `['22.18', 24, 26]` matrix proves it on every push and PR rather than trusting the manifest.
|
||||
- The built-bin smoke needs no version-conditional flag: at 22.18 type-stripping is already the default, so the test stays the plain `node lib/bin.js` path it documents.
|
||||
- A future change reaching for a Node 23+ API fails `tsc` immediately (the `@types/node` pin); one reaching for an API added in 22.19/22.20 — inside the 22.x type surface but above the floor — is caught instead by the 22.18 matrix leg. Either way the floor must move in the same change.
|
||||
- The `vendor/hmr` and `vendor/loader` comments about Node 24 module-cache internals are unaffected — they describe dev-time HMR loader behavior, not the shipped runtime contract, and are pinned vendored source.
|
||||
|
||||
## Alternatives considered
|
||||
|
||||
- **Floor `>=22.13` (the `node:sqlite` boundary) plus `--experimental-strip-types` in the built-bin smoke on 22.13–22.17.** Rejected: it adds a version-conditional test flag for one narrow range and dresses up an experimental-flag dependency as first-class support. 22.18 clears both boundaries with zero test special-casing, and the five-patch gap below it buys nothing real.
|
||||
- **Keep `>=24`.** Rejected: it excludes Node 22 LTS with no runtime justification once the two boundaries above are known.
|
||||
- **Open-ended `>=22.18`.** Rejected: it advertises support for Node 23.0–23.5, where `node:sqlite` (until 23.4) or type-stripping (until 23.6) is still flagged, so the sqlite backend throws at load. The disjoint `^22.18.0 || >=24.0.0` matches the real runtime boundary.
|
||||
- **Include Node 23.6+ (`^22.18.0 || >=23.6.0`).** Rejected: 23.6+ does run both features unflagged, but Node 23 is end-of-life — advertising a dead release line adds a range term (and, to back it, a CI leg) for a runtime no deployment should use. 24 is the meaningful resumption point, and the 22.18 and 24 legs already bracket the same unflagged code paths.
|
||||
- **Matrix `[22, 24, 26]` (latest 22.x) instead of pinning `22.18`.** Rejected: "latest 22.x" drifts upward over time and would silently stop exercising the declared floor. Pinning the floor version is what makes the matrix a proof of the claim rather than a proof of some newer 22.x.
|
||||
- **Keep `@types/node` ahead of the floor (`^25`).** Rejected: types ahead of the runtime floor let a Node 24/25-only API compile clean and fail only at runtime on 22.18 — exactly the "green types, broken product" gap. Pinning `@types/node` to the 22.x line turns that into a compile error everywhere, and the tree already typechecks clean against the Node 22 surface, so the pin is free.

# RFC: Raise the Node LTS engine floor to 22.19
|
||||
|
||||
Status: implemented
|
||||
|
||||
## Problem
|
||||
|
||||
The Node 22 branch of the root `engines.node` range is a contract for the installed workspace, not only for the runtime APIs the harness source calls directly. It must be no lower than package `engines.node` declarations for dependencies the workspace installs on that branch; otherwise `pnpm install --engine-strict` fails at an advertised LTS version, and non-strict installs run outside a dependency's supported runtime.
|
||||
|
||||
## Decision
|
||||
|
||||
Set `engines.node` to `^22.19.0 || >=24.0.0` and test the keyless CI compatibility matrix on `['22.19', 24, 26]`. The real-API e2e workflow stays on Node 24 because it exercises API integration rather than the runtime floor.
|
||||
|
||||
Two Node features gate the source runtime:
|
||||
|
||||
- **`node:sqlite`** — `packages/session-persistence/session-persistence-sqlite` does a top-level `import { DatabaseSync } from 'node:sqlite'`. The module dropped its `--experimental-sqlite` flag requirement at **22.13** (LTS) and **23.4** (Current); before those, importing it throws at load.
|
||||
- **Native TypeScript type-stripping** — the `packages/ui/stdio-agent/tests/built-bin.e2e.ts` smoke boots the published `lib/bin.js` under plain `node` (no tsx) and loads the example's `.ts` plugins (`mock-llm.ts`, `echo-tool.ts`). Type-stripping is the default from **22.18** (LTS) and **23.6** (Current); before those it needs `--experimental-strip-types`.
|
||||
|
||||
Those source features clear on the 22.x line at **22.18**, but the installed Pi adapter dependency raises the advertised LTS floor. `@deepseek-ai/dsh-llm-pi-ai` depends on `@earendil-works/pi-ai@0.79.3`, whose package declares `engines.node >=22.19.0`, so the LTS floor is **22.19**. The 24.x branch remains `>=24.0.0`. The disjoint range excludes Node 23 entirely: Node 23.0–23.5 still has at least one flagged source feature, and the 23 line is non-LTS/EOL, so advertising `>=23.6` would add a dead release line and a CI leg no deployment should use.
|
||||
|
||||
`@types/node` remains pinned to the 22.x line (`^22.20.0`) to match the LTS support line: reaching for a Node 23+/24+/25+ API fails `tsc` on every machine and in the typecheck gate, rather than compiling clean and surviving to a runtime failure only a floor matrix leg could catch. The whole tree typechecks clean against the Node 22 type surface today, so the pin costs nothing.
|
||||
|
||||
## Consequences
|
||||
|
||||
- The advertised LTS branch no longer undercuts the Pi adapter dependency floor.
|
||||
- CI proves the Node 22 LTS floor directly with Node 22.19, keeps the Node 24 branch on `node: 24`, and keeps Node 26 for the next even line.
|
||||
- The built-bin smoke needs no version-conditional flag: at 22.19 type-stripping is already the default, so the test stays the plain `node lib/bin.js` path it documents.
|
||||
- A future dependency or source API that raises the runtime floor must move `engines.node`, the compatibility matrix, and this RFC in the same change.
|
||||
|
||||
## Alternatives considered
|
||||
|
||||
- **Keep `^22.18.0 || >=24.0.0`.** Rejected: it advertises an LTS version lower than the Pi adapter dependency floor. `@earendil-works/pi-ai@0.79.3` requires `>=22.19.0`.
|
||||
- **Downgrade or pin `@earendil-works/pi-ai` to preserve the 22.18 advertised range.** Rejected: the current Pi adapter dependency is part of the intended workspace, and 22.19 is still inside the Node 22 LTS line.
|
||||
- **Floor `>=22.13` (the `node:sqlite` boundary) plus `--experimental-strip-types` in the built-bin smoke on 22.13–22.17.** Rejected: it adds a version-conditional test flag for one narrow range and dresses up an experimental-flag dependency as first-class support. The Pi adapter dependency already requires a higher LTS floor.
|
||||
- **Open-ended `>=22.19`.** Rejected: it advertises support for Node 23.0–23.5, where `node:sqlite` (until 23.4) or type-stripping (until 23.6) is still flagged.
|
||||
- **Include Node 23.6+ (`^22.19.0 || >=23.6.0`).** Rejected: 23.6+ does run both source features unflagged, but Node 23 is end-of-life; advertising a dead release line adds a range term and a CI leg for a runtime no deployment should use.
|
||||
- **Matrix `[22, 24, 26]` instead of pinning `22.19`.** Rejected: floating major-version entries drift upward over time and silently stop exercising the declared LTS floor.
|
||||
- **Keep `@types/node` ahead of the floor (`^25`).** Rejected: types ahead of the runtime floor let a Node 24/25-only API compile clean and fail only at runtime on 22.x. Pinning `@types/node` to the 22.x line turns that into a compile error everywhere.
